How long is the typical travel time from San Antonio International Airport (SAT) to Tepic International Airport (TPET) in September?
Typical total travel time from San Antonio International Airport (SAT) to Tepic International Airport (TPET) in September ranges from about 5 to 9 hours including a single layover, depending on connection times and routing via Guadalajara or Mexico City. Flight segments often run ~2 to 2.5 hours to a Mexican hub plus ~1 to 1.5 hours onward to Tepic, with connection windows varying. When booking, prioritize shorter layovers that still meet minimum connection times to avoid delays.
What are the average round-trip airfare ranges from San Antonio International Airport (SAT) to Tepic International Airport (TPET) in September?
Average round-trip fares from San Antonio International Airport (SAT) to Tepic International Airport (TPET) in September typically fall between $350 and $700 depending on how far in advance you book, whether travel coincides with Mexican Independence Day mid-September, and airline choice. Booking 3 to 7 weeks in advance and flying midweek often yields the best cheaper flight deals. Sign up for fare alerts, check flexible-date calendars, and compare Southwest, American, United, and regional Mexican carriers for savings.
